Anti-Ligature Hospital Wall Clock

Patients in healthcare settings sometimes pose a risk to themselves or others, and anti-ligature hospital equipment is crucial for ensuring safety. An security wall clock is specifically designed to prevent injury by eliminating accessible features that could be used as ligatures. Constructed with smooth, rounded surfaces and securely mounted to the wall, these clocks offer a secure timekeeping solution without compromising patient welfare.

Safety Clock

In healthcare settings, patient security is paramount. Clinical grade anti-ligature clocks play a crucial role in minimizing risks associated with injuries. These specialized clocks are engineered to eliminate the potential for patients to use them as objects for self-ligation. Constructed from durable substances, they feature a reinforced design with minimal protrusions or removable parts that could be used in harmful ways.

  • Moreover, anti-ligature clocks often feature non-toxic finishings to minimize the risk of negative reactions.
  • Commonly, they are secured sturdily to walls or furniture, preventing removal.
  • Beyond their primary function, these clocks provide a clear and legible time display, promoting a sense of order in the patient environment.

By prioritizing safety without compromising functionality, hospital grade anti-ligature clocks contribute to a protective healthcare setting for both patients and staff.
